Explore the innovative method of neurographics for creating and re-creating the world in this 15-minute TEDx talk by Kostadinka Hristowa. Discover how this Bulgarian philology graduate and experienced teacher at Samokov's "Konstantin Fotinov" high school combines her passion for culture, arts, technology, psychology, and human relations with innovative teaching methods. Learn about Hristowa's professional journey, including her publications, methodological developments, and integration of digital applications in literature and language classes. Gain insights into her leadership of various student clubs, particularly the successful school magazine "#Apostrophe'ART". Understand how neurographics, a method for personal and creative transformation, has influenced Hristowa's approach to education and life, and how it can be applied to face daily challenges and foster continuous learning and growth.
